An Original Vintage Theatrical Linenbacked French One-Panel "Grande" Movie Poster (1p; measures 46 3/4" x 62 3/4" [119 x 159 cm]) (Learn More)

Novecento (released in the U.S. in 1977 as "1900"), the 1976 Bernardo Bertolucci French/German/Italian historical epic ("Europe's most important, powerful and forceful motion picture ever...!"; "A compelling, unforgettable story of human nature, human existence, of the constant struggle against the oppression of tyranny. From the cradle to the grave- victims of history and change!";"The motion picture for your century."; "A film by Bernardo Bertolucci"; "Screenplay by Franco Arcalli"; set in changing Italy) starring Robert De Niro, Gerard Depardieu, Dominique Sanda, Francesca Bertini, Laura Betti, Werner Bruhns, Stefania Casini, Sterling Hayden, Anna Henkel, Ellen Schwiers, Alida Valli, Romolo Valli, Stefania Sandrelli, Donald Sutherland, and Burt Lancaster. Note that this movie was over four hours long, so it was released in two parts in some countries, and released in cut versions in other countries!

Artist: Jean Mascii & Jouineau Bourduge
Important Added Info: Note that this is a "country of origin" poster for this partially French movie!

What IS linenbacking? Learn More

Overall Condition and Pre-Restoration Defects with Quality of Restoration: good. The poster had darkening down the right 16" of the poster, but it is fairly faint, and it is clearly noticeable, but it is not all that distracting! The poster was backed on to a very thin linen, apparently because someone wanted to remove the foldlines and to be able to easily display the poster. There is no excess linen, and no restoration was performed.
